background

The horror genre has seen a resurgence in recent years, with many filmmakers drawing inspiration from classic movies. Eli Roth's latest film, Ice Cream Man, is no exception, as it pays homage to several iconic horror films. The movie's plot is reminiscent of Village of the Damned, a 1960 British science fiction horror film about a small town where a group of children are possessed by an otherworldly force. Ice Cream Man also draws parallels with the opening scene of Halloween, a seminal horror film that introduced the world to Michael Myers.

Ice Cream Man's blend of horror and dark humor is not new, but it attempts to carve out its own niche in the genre. The film's marketing campaign has generated significant buzz, with many horror fans eagerly anticipating its release. However, the question remains whether Ice Cream Man can live up to the hype and deliver a unique viewing experience.

The film's premise, which involves a group of zombie-like children, has been compared to other movies such as Weapons. While these comparisons are inevitable, they also raise expectations about the film's quality and originality. As a result, Ice Cream Man faces an uphill battle in terms of distinguishing itself from its influences and meeting the expectations of horror fans.

what happened

Ice Cream Man has been reviewed by several critics, with many expressing disappointment and frustration with the film. According to some reviews, the movie relies too heavily on a single joke and fails to deliver a compelling narrative. The film's attempt to blend horror and dark humor has been criticized for being unoriginal and lacking in depth.
